Accounting questions

My investments is $1500.00. If I bought supplies for cash for $400.00, where would the $400.00 go under on my accounting work sheet?

Debit Supplies 400
Credit Cash 400

That means increase Supplies (an asset account) by 400 and decrease Cash (an asset account) by 400
